No order, subpoena, or subpoena duces tecum for the purpose of obtaining or compelling the production or inspection of medical, hospital, or other records relating to a person’s medical treatment, history, or condition, including a subpoena or order issued under Article 1463 and including a subpoena compelling the attendance of the custodian of records or other employee of the health care provider, either by name, title, or position, in connection with such production, shall be granted or issued except as provided in La. Rev. Stat. 13:3715.1.

Acts 1986, No. 1046, §1; Acts 1988, No. 980, §1; Acts 1995, No. 1250, §1.
